QUESTION 344
A technician is working on a user’s PC. After testing the theory of the cause, which of the following could the technician perform NEXT? (Select TWO).
A. |
Resolve issue |
B. |
Inform user |
C. |
New theory or escalate |
D. |
Document issue |
E. |
Verify system functionality |
Correct Answer: AC
Explanation:
When you have tested the theory of cause, resolve the issue using troubleshooting techniques and if the issue is not resolved after the troubleshooting measure, reestablish the theory and escalate the issue to higher authorities.
